Activities Assistant / Support Worker

Location: St Albans

Salary: £12.50 per hour

Job Type: Part-Time

We’re looking for a compassionate and creative Activities Assistant to join a warm and welcoming elderly care setting in St Albans. This is a rewarding role ideal for someone with a background in care or support who enjoys enriching the lives of older adults through meaningful, person-centred activities.

What You\’ll Do:

  • Plan and lead a range of engaging daily activities
  • Encourage resident participation and boost social interaction
  • Tailor activities to meet individual needs and mobility levels
  • Contribute to a positive, inclusive and uplifting environment

What We’re Looking For:

  • Previous experience in care, support work or a similar setting
  • Creative, enthusiastic, and well-organised
  • Excellent communication and people skills
  • Enhanced DBS (or willingness to obtain one)

This is a fantastic opportunity to bring joy, connection, and purpose into the everyday lives of older people. If you’re someone who thrives on making others smile, we’d love to hear from you.

How to prepare for a job interview at IntSol Care Personnel

✨Show Your Compassion

As an Activities Assistant, empathy is key. Be prepared to share examples of how you've positively impacted the lives of others in previous roles. This will demonstrate your genuine care for the residents.

✨Highlight Your Creativity

Think of engaging activities you could implement for the elderly. During the interview, suggest a few ideas that cater to different interests and mobility levels, showcasing your ability to tailor activities to individual needs.

✨Demonstrate Communication Skills

Effective communication is crucial in this role. Practice articulating your thoughts clearly and confidently. You might also want to prepare for questions about how you would handle difficult conversations with residents or their families.

✨Prepare for Scenario Questions

Expect scenario-based questions that assess your problem-solving skills. Think about past experiences where you had to adapt activities or resolve conflicts, and be ready to discuss how you handled those situations.
